Comprehending Bay Windows
Before delving into the replacement process, it's essential to comprehend what bay windows are. A bay window typically consists of a main window flanked by 2 angled side windows. This design protrudes from the main walls of the home, creating a small nook or alcove within. They offer panoramic views and permit more sunlight than standard flat windows.

Comprehending the signs that suggest a bay window replacement impends can save house owners from additional home damage. Keep an eye out for the following:
Condensation: If wetness builds up inside the window panes, it might show a seal failure.Drafts: Feeling a draft near a closed window can signify inadequate insulation.Decomposing Frame: Check the frame and sill for signs of wood rot, which might need replacement.Dirt and Mold: Persistent filth or mold growth around the window might indicate water infiltration.Difficulty Opening/Closing: If the windows do not operate efficiently, it may be time for an upgrade.Kinds Of Bay Windows

Replacing bay windows requires cautious preparation and execution. Here's a detailed guide to the procedure:
1. Evaluate Your NeedsFigure out why you're changing your bay windows-- is it for better performance, looks, or structural reasons?2. Choose the Right Style and MaterialsThink about the architectural design of your home. Popular products consist of vinyl, wood, and fiberglass.3. Procedure AccuratelyMake sure exact measurements are taken for the brand-new windows. This step is important for the stability and look of the end product.4. Hire a Professional or DIYDecide if the replacement will be a DIY project or if it needs professional installation. Consulting an expert is suggested for complex structures.5. Eliminate the Old Bay WindowThoroughly remove the old window, making sure not to harm surrounding locations.6. Install the New Bay WindowPlace the new window in the designated area, ensuring it fits comfortably and is level.7. Protect and SealAttach the window securely and use weather condition stripping and caulking to prevent air leakages.8. Include Finishing TouchesRepaint or refinish the interior and exterior as necessary to match your home's design.Cost of Bay Window Replacement

FAQs About Bay Window Replacement
1. How long does it take to replace a bay window?Typically, the replacement can take anywhere from a couple of hours to a full day, depending on the intricacy of the installation. 2. Do I require a license to change my bay window?It depends upon local policies.
